Output ce8434900c4de0f321418df59e92fb9f0ea15fb49d6da8ddf5941df2919754ef:49

value
17622770
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f5d20482e22765ae844e99246dec81cd9fb9af9 OP_EQUALVERIFY OP_CHECKSIG
address
12QEhPm66KWDA9XYGAcbjrkXXaWQXnQbVy
transaction
ce8434900c4de0f321418df59e92fb9f0ea15fb49d6da8ddf5941df2919754ef
confirmations
563666
spent
false

1 Sat Range